Windows update may revoke the original license key on your PC. It may also happen after Windows recovery or re-install. In this case, you can re-register the product key again. If you have bought a laptop with an original license then you can find the product key glued on the bottom. Once you find it, note it. Here you need to enter the key you have noted.

You may find tons of tools and cracks online to fix this issue. Also to note that this is always displayed whenever you install a Evaluation Copy or pre-release copy. If this has shown on your desktop because you have installed Windows 7 SP1 Beta, I would suggest you to leave it because when SP1 Final Version comes out, you will be notified.

Then you can first un install Windows 7 SP1 Beta and install the final version. This will automatically remove the Windows 7 Evaluation Copy Build watermark. At the end I would like to say that there is nothing wrong with these watermark showing up unless you have install patches etc from some where else and not from Microsoft Itself.
